Great game, definitely forgettable though. Mostly boring or outright annoying characters, bland music, less charming base of operations to come back to, boons blended together way more with some options just generally being objectively better to choose (see the damage numbers for Aphrodite), visually way too busy areas that you get stuck on the environment or lose your character in the chaos (not to mention multiple spots where the camera outright tracks to somewhere else and off your character), and an outright poorly told/developed story.

It's still a great game in a lot of ways, but the first Hades was a much tighter experience that has stuck with me way more than I feel this will. Supergiant needs to move on to other projects. Maybe there was a reason they made something new every time instead of doing sequels honestly.

Give or take five runs for the underworld path, then 5 runs for the surface path. You'll likely have to do another 10-20 runs though before you actually see a victory or get the dialogue that unlocks end game incantations needed to reach credits. That, and the curse that Eris puts on you makes blazing through early runs a nightmare on purpose.

So, probably about 15-30 hours if you're on top of things and decent at the game/lucky with boons. There's an epilogue as well, but it's genuinely nothing of value. That, and the requirements are obnoxious because you have to progress dialogue with characters, some of which are only 3/4s of the way through a run, that will stack up dialogue related to entirely separate quest lines. I had to do a run to speak with a certain boss at least 10 or 15 times before they said a thing I needed to progress. Shit's obnoxious how its designed.
